Basketball team needs support
In response to Greg Meuli’s editorial in Wednesday’s edition of The Daily Gamecock, how do people think Darrin Horn is a bad coach? This past season was only Horn’s third. His first season included 22 wins and a co-SEC East regular season championship, and he led USC to its first win over a No. 1 team in the program’s history. Meuli mentions that numerous players have been released by Horn. It wasn’t mentioned, however, that Chad Gray and Mike Holmes were also kicked off Coastal Carolina’s team after continuing their collegiate careers, and that only two of the seven players released were actually Horn’s.
Horn is slowly reviving the program; he just needs a little more time. I am not saying we are going to be a national powerhouse, but many fans wanted legendary Duke coach Mike Krzyzewski to be fired after he went to the NIT his first year, followed by two losing seasons. Four NCAA championships and 27 NCAA tournament appearances later, they are happy he stayed. So do we really want to fire a young coach working hard for honest success and hire a coach who was just fired for lying to the NCAA? Have some faith, Gamecock nation. It took us over 100 years to win an NCAA championship in a major sport — I think we can give Horn another year or two.
